What Is the Indian Forehead Jewelry Called? The Truth About Temple Jewellery

The Indian forehead jewelry is called a maang tikka-a traditional ornament worn by women during weddings and ceremonies. Rooted in temple jewelry traditions, it’s more than decoration-it carries cultural and spiritual meaning.
